EVO RS...at last mine!!!

Brief introduction, I just picked up a red Evo RS this past weekend !
Finally, Evo in my possession! Couple observations:

- it rocks in handling, firm and stiff (definitely my daily car)
- good streaming power (still breaking it in at 300miles)
- less lag than my puny T25 Eclipse spyder (hows that possible?)
- whole lot of room (great future family car)
- car feels light! (maybe RS factor?)
- Recaro's are so comfy (best seats yet, for my aching back!)
- luv the stripped trunk
- ditto crank window but could use power locks
- paid $500 under invoice (loyalty prog), $27,200 on the road!

Couple issue though:
- at times, front right strut makes sqeaking and clanking noise!!!
- when foot is off throttle, engine or tyranny makes grinding noise (this normal?)

Overall, this car inspires so much confidence! Now I feel safe on highways!

Can other RS owners chime in on issues???

thx
